Roles and Responsibilities of Peon / Office Attendant
The Peon role may seem simple, but it involves multiple responsibilities that are essential for the daily functioning of university offices.
Office Support Work
Peons assist administrative staff in routine office work such as arranging files, organizing documents, and ensuring that office materials are properly maintained. They help maintain discipline and order in office spaces.
File and Document Movement
One of the key responsibilities is delivering files, letters, and official documents between departments. This ensures smooth communication within the university.
Cleaning and Maintenance
Peons are responsible for maintaining cleanliness in offices, meeting rooms, and corridors. A clean working environment is essential for productivity.
Assisting Staff and Visitors
They help faculty members, administrative officers, and visitors by guiding them, arranging meeting spaces, and providing basic assistance when required.
Overall, the role requires basic physical activity, attention to instructions, and a cooperative attitude.

Selection Process
The selection process for Pune University Peon jobs is structured but relatively simple compared to high-level government exams.
Written Test: Candidates may be required to appear for a basic written exam that includes general knowledge, reasoning, and simple language questions.
Interview: Shortlisted candidates are called for a basic interview to assess their behavior, communication, and suitability for the role.
Document Verification: All educational and identity documents are verified to ensure authenticity.
Medical Examination: Candidates must pass a basic health check to confirm fitness for duty.
